I have been an L1'er (Model 1) for almost two years. I have been gigging now for the past couple of months pretty regularly. But...I have been doing so sans the T1.

Well circumstances have sort of forced me to purchase the T1 (I am hosting an open-mic night this week with my L1 and I wanted to make sure I had the best I could have)...so...I placed my order and received the T1 the other day! I toyed with it last night and this morning. Up to now, I've been using the L1 remote with a Digitec Vocalist Live 2 as well as the VL2's reverb/compression function. I do have a Shure SM58 which is a preset on the L1 base.

So last night, I downloaded the Breedlove Atlas preset (I have a Breed Atlas Dred), plugged my guitar directly into the T1 and WOOOWWWW! The color that was added to my guitar was simply incredible. I was truly blown away. It really was a joyous sound. And I would have never believed there would be such a difference.

Up to now, I thought to myself..."The T1 just can't be that big of a difference. My guitar sounds fine as is."

Well folks...don't judge until you have tried it!!!! The difference is just incredible. And its one of those things you have to hear for yourself. Words can't describe the fullness and color the T1 adds to my guitar.

And a further note...I then ran the guitar through the VL2 using it only for the harmonies and I could not tell the difference between the sound of the guitar running through the VL2 vs. running directly into the T1. At least not to me.
